To unlock your device, from the lock screen, press the
S PenÂ
button.
Note: You can only unlock your device using your S Pen when a screen lock is setup, air actions are enabled and S Pen unlock is enabled. To enable Air actions, swipe down from the Notification bar > select the
Settings icon > scroll to and select Advanced features > select S Pen >  Air actions switch. Â

Turn Air view on or off
Air view allows you to preview information, extend text, or enlarge pictures by hovering your pen over the screen. From the S Pen settings screen, select the
Air view switch.Â
